Spotify: UMG deal is close

Spotify, the popular European digital music service, is “a few weeks away” from inking a deal for US rights to songs from Universal Music Group, the world’s largest music company, according to people familiar with the talks.

But the London-based start-up, which was valued at up to $1 billion this week by investors according to reports, could end up launching without Warner Music Group, the No. 3 music label group, one person said.
